Malacca, also known as Melaka, is a charming town situated in Malaysia that is certainly steeped in record and culture. From Discovering historical web-sites to indulging in scrumptious neighborhood Delicacies, there are lots of issues to perform in Malacca for people of all pursuits. Here's an intensive overview of The https://jolenee310ocp5.wizzardsblog.com/profile